Transaction 072f56b1398655e82aba4e73aab3e1f814334609a861eacfde5241dc581715d0
2 Input
2 Outputs
- 072f56b1398655e82aba4e73aab3e1f814334609a861eacfde5241dc581715d0:0
- 072f56b1398655e82aba4e73aab3e1f814334609a861eacfde5241dc581715d0:1
value 116198644
address 3JZNZqJGeBszhS4vieroKGpTUzjy2nTnEy
value 84528804
address 1NLmwWHfqZ9NfKztSFUQHJV2b5jGfgWeRV